Automotive qualified ASIC for battery control applications

The IC permanently measures battery voltage, battery current, battery temperature and battery lifetime to compute the State-Of-Charge (SOC) and the State-Of-Health (SOH) of batteries. The ASIC targets applications such as high-voltage battery systems (Li-Ion) for vehicles (trains, cars, motorbikes, …) as well as Lead-Acid battery systems (12V, 24V and 42V). This ASIC is a general purpose platform for battery control applications.

FEATURES

  • Accurate current, voltage and temperature measurements of battery
  • State-of-Health, State-of-Charge computation
  • High flexibility through external component selection
  • Battery reverse connection protection
  • EMC, disturbance signal immunity (ISO 7637-1/3)
  • -40°C to 150°C
  • 0.35um BCD 50V technology
